Is ASDA Ham & Cheese Toastie Gluten Free?


Ingredients
Fortified Wheat Flour (wheat Flour, Calcium Carbonate, Niacin (b3), Iron, Thiamin (b1)), Cheddar Cheese (milk) (19%), Water, Oak Smoked Formed Ham With Added Water (17%) (pork (92%), Water, Salt, Stabiliser (triphosphates), Antioxidant (sodium Ascorbate), Preservative (sodium Nitrite)), Mozzarella Cheese (milk) (7%), Unsalted Butter (milk), Skimmed Milk Powder, Yeast, Salt, Emulsifiers (mono- And Diglycerides Of Fatty Acids, Mono- And Diacetyl Tartaric Acid Esters Of Mono- And Diglycerides Of Fatty Acids), Wheat Protein, Double Cream (milk), Rapeseed Oil, Flour Treatment Agent (ascorbic Acid), Wheat Flour, Wheat Starch. Contains Milk, Wheat.
What is a Gluten Free diet?
A gluten-free diet excludes all foods containing gluten, a protein found in wheat, barley, rye, and their derivatives. It's essential for people with celiac disease, gluten intolerance, or wheat allergy, as consuming gluten can trigger inflammation and digestive issues. Common gluten-containing foods include bread, pasta, cereals, and baked goods, though many gluten-free alternatives now exist using rice, corn, or almond flour. Beyond medical necessity, some people choose a gluten-free lifestyle for perceived health benefits, though experts emphasize the importance of maintaining a balanced diet rich in fiber, vitamins, and minerals when eliminating gluten-containing grains.
